Georgia Health News Tribute: Dawn Alford Cleared The Path For Others With Disabilities

“She really changed people’s minds about disabilities and really opened hearts,’’ state Rep. Mary Frances Williams of Marietta said of Dawn Alford, who was a public policy director and lobbyist at the state Capitol for the Georgia Council on Developmental Disabilities.

Courtesy of Georgia Health News

Editorial note: This is a reporter’s tribute to a Georgian beloved by people from all walks of life and all shades of opinion. 

As a lobbyist, Dawn Alford was smart, tenacious and effective. As a person, she was unfailingly pleasant, greeting people with a big smile.

And as a woman with disabilities, Dawn set a compelling example of what’s possible. She influenced countless individuals she met, affecting how they viewed people with physical or intellectual disabilities.
